Acliffe Hill
Acliffe Hill is a peak in Broughton, Craven District, England and has an elevation of 587 feet. Acliffe Hill is situated nearby to the village Broughton, as well as near East Marton.Places of Interest

Gargrave is a railway station on the Bentham Line, which runs between Leeds and Morecambe via Skipton. The station, situated 30 miles north-west of Leeds, serves the village of Gargrave in North Yorkshire.

All Saints' Church is the parish church of Broughton, a village in North Yorkshire, in England. No church in Broughton is recorded in the Domesday Book, the first reference to one being in 1120.

Bank Newton is a small settlement and civil parish county of North Yorkshire, England. According to the 2001 census the parish had a population of 47, and at the 2011 census the population of the civil parish remained less than 100 and therefore its details were included in the civil parish of Gargrave.

West Marton is a village in the county of North Yorkshire, England. It is on the A59 road about 6.5 miles west of the market town of Skipton, and 8 miles north of Colne.
